Window Cost by Type
Replacing your windows is a substantial investment, so balancing cost with value is vital. Choosing budget windows could actually raise your overall cost, due to their reduced lifespan and more intensive maintenance needs. The size, material, and style of your new windows play the largest role in determining your final cost. Transom windows are inexpensive with their simple size and straightforward form factor, while new skylights cost more to prepare for and install. An installer can guide you through selecting the options that fit your preferences.

Window Material Cost
Materials also help determine a window's cost. You might choose a material based on your energy efficiency goals, the local climate, and your desired look. For example, wood windows can give your home an organic design without breaking the bank, but you'll have to invest more toward maintenance. Aluminum and composite windows cost more up-front, but they're incredibly durable in Clermont's strong storms, so you'll spend far less on maintenance.

Licensing and Credentials
Window companies in Florida need a general, glazing, or residential license from the state Construction Industry Licensing Board. Some licenses permit companies to operate in one location only, while others enable crews to work across the state. Cities might have their own extra licenses, but they cannot overlap with licenses that the state oversees.

Customer Feedback
Perhaps the best way to evaluate window companies for your job is to check what previous customers have said about them. You can find customer reviews on websites like Google, the BBB, Trustpilot, and Yelp. Referrals can also help you in your company search. Ask each company you're interested in for a list of references, and talk to family and friends about who they use for window installations.
